Transaction d4a10cca015fddda24dc5a8d6dcd720c381b85d9ff54d6b2a537e23a7f398f26

block
a59cce65110143d948864615cb30a1d161320cd8a6063b0aa0315bcf33ab3f8b

1 Input

23 Outputs